Details
The Opal Estate plugin for WordPress is vulnerable to featured property modifications in versions up to, and including, 1.6.11. This is due to missing capability checks on the opalestate_set_feature_property() and opalestate_remove_feature_property() functions. This makes it possible for unauthenticated attackers to set and remove featured properties.
